Central Warehousing Corporation Senior Assistant Manager salaries in India (Updated 2025)

Annual salary range
0 - 9 years exp.
₹11.8 Lakhs - ₹15.1 Lakhs

The training,job security, salary, appraisal, learning etc is excellent. Earlier the career growth was not good. I am extremely sorry to mention that I spent 34 yrs of my golden age serving the company starting in the yr 1982 but I got my first promotion to upper scale in the year 1996 i.e.after 14 years. Second in2002& 3rd in Feb 2015. However some sort of improvement is seen, still it is a long way to get the best. Organisation is excellent but one thing is most unfortunate that the senior executive officer of the company has a very narrow approach , narrow thinking, cunningness towards their colleagues which stillneeds much more time to create fairly environment. ... The work culture is from good to excellent depending upon the place of posting.The salary package is very good. Mostly the Jobs are in the warehouses where the work is to be done beyond office hours. One has to do every type of work without considering his job profile. The job security is 100%.

Central Warehousing Corporation Senior Assistant Manager salary in India ranges between ₹11.8 Lakhs to ₹15.1 Lakhs. This is an estimate based on latest salaries received from employees of Central Warehousing Corporation.
